Sea surface freshening inferred from SMOS and ARGO salinity: impact of rain
TL;DR: In this paper, the accuracy of SMOS SSS averaged over 10 days, 100 × 100 km2 in the open ocean and estimated by comparison to ARGO (Array for Real-Time Geostrophic Oceanography) SSS is on the order of 0.3-0.4 in tropical and subtropical regions and 0.5 in a cold region.

In Situ-Based Reanalysis of the Global Ocean Temperature and Salinity with ISAS: Variability of the Heat Content and Steric Height
Fabienne Gaillard,Thierry Reynaud,Virginie Thierry,Nicolas Kolodziejczyk,Karina von Schuckmann +4 more
TL;DR: The In Situ Analysis System (ISAS) was developed to produce gridded fields of temperature and salinity that preserve as much as possible the time and space sampling capabilities of the Argo network of profiling floats.

Variability of the meridional overturning circulation at the Greenland-Portugal OVIDE section from 1993 to 2010
Herlé Mercier,Pascale Lherminier,Artem Sarafanov,Fabienne Gaillard,Nathalie Daniault,Damien Desbruyères,Anastasia Falina,Bruno Ferron,Claire Gourcuff,Thierry Huck,Virginie Thierry +10 more
TL;DR: In this paper, the authors discuss the variability of the gyre circulation, the MOC and heat flux as quantified from a joint analysis of hydrographic and velocity data from six repeats of the Greenland to Portugal OVIDE section (1997-2010).
